What three kinds of particles are the main building blocks of an atom?

A) nucleus, proteus, lattice
B) spheroid, cube, tetrahedron
C) proton, neutron, electron
D) hydrogen, helium, bohrium
E) none of these

Proton

Principal particle of an atomic nucleus with a positive charge.

Neutron

A subatomic particle that contributes mass to a nucleus and is electrically neutral.

Electron

A stable, subatomic particle with a negative charge.

Final Answer :
C
Explanation :
Atoms are primarily composed of protons, neutrons, and electrons. Protons and neutrons form the nucleus at the center of the atom, while electrons orbit around the nucleus.
